Commitment to safeguarding
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.
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.
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children
You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.

We are a friendly, nurturing, inclusive school set in beautiful, extensive grounds on the edge of Market Harborough. We currently have approximately 300 children on roll including our Preschool and our school is growing, with six additional classrooms completed in January 2019.
Our vision is for Farndon Fields to be a high achieving, vibrant learning community in which children are nurtured, motivated and have outstanding expectations for themselves and others. We believe that every member of our school community has a right to achieve their potential in an atmosphere which balances support with challenge. We provide a climate for learning which encourages creativity, is enjoyable, safe, exciting, and well-structured. We are passionate about improving the health and life choices for all our children and our school ethos promotes health, well–being, self-esteem and resilience and these are the foundations for our children to be successful in all they do. Our goal - underpinned by our four foundation stones of Nurture, Inspire, Learn, Succeed - is to develop life-long learning characteristics in children that encourage self leadership skills, helping each child to be the very best they can be.
We enjoy close links with our parents and community. We believe that strong and effective parent partnerships are key to the successful academic, social and emotional development of the children in our care. We also have established collaborative partnerships with other schools in the locality, in our Trust, with the Affinity Teaching School Alliance and Inspiring Leaders Teacher Training. In a rapidly changing educational landscape, we know that working in partnership is a vital way to grow our capacity and improve on the achievement of our school. Here at Farndon Fields we recognise that progress can come from the power of many if we have a common aim: to achieve success for all.
